I know most 360 owners here have their consoles hacked, but I do not plan on doing so because I want to play on live when I go back to the US. I bought my 360 in the US and I'm having trouble locating games other than www.play-asia.com

I was wondering if anyone could give me or direct me to a decent list of developers that make region-free games. I know Namco and Ubisoft do, but I'm sure there are others and I would like information about this. I really hope Bethesda does cause I want to get Fallout3 soon. Any help people?

Just look online. It is not a matter of the game manufacturer but the title. Different titles have different region coding. You just have to look up each game on the internet to find out about the region coding.

But the problem is not the region coding. The problem is the language. Most games I play I need in English. So I have to buy games abroad too. No big deal really.
